Responsibilities:
- Inspect various facets of work on the construction site.
- Take field measurements and perform calculations.
- Prepare relevant inspection reports.
- Verify that appropriate materials and construction processes are being used.
- Ensure that construction conforms to the project plans, specifications, and special provisions.
- Perform other duties as assigned
MINIMUM EXPERIENCE AND TRAINING:
One (1) year minimum PennDOT experience as a Transportation Construction Inspector 1 (TCI-1) or higher and has one (1) of the following three (3) certifications: PennDOT Concrete Technician Certification, NECEPT Field Technician Certification, or NICET Level II Certification or higher in Highway Construction, only NICET Certifications in Highway Construction are allowed unless special circumstances of other NICET subfields are requested for Central Office approval.
Or
Three (3) years minimum of transportation, highway, or bridge construction inspection experience, and has one (1) of the following three (3) certifications: PennDOT Concrete Technician Certification, NECEPT Field Technician Certification, or NICET Level II Certification or higher in Highway Construction, only NICET Certifications in Highway Construction are allowed unless special circumstances of other NICET subfields are requested for Central Office approval.
Or
Four (4) years minimum transportation, highway, or bridge construction inspection experience.
Or
Five (5) years minimum of highway or bridge construction or highway or bridge design experience and non- 7 inspection personnel must successfully complete the twelve (12) web-based TCI training modules.
Or
Holds a Bachelor of Science degree in Civil Engineering or Construction Management.
Or
Holds an active Professional Engineer's License.
Note: Associate degree in Civil Engineering or Construction Management may be substituted for two (2) years of experience.
